Significance
Forklifts are a really effective way to transport product. They are a modern way to transport products and materials in a wide range of settings. Forklifts are used to move things that are heavy and bulky which would otherwise need to be moved by hand in smaller units.

Function
Forklifts could reach racks as high as 9 to 12 meters. This allows efficient use of maximum storage capacity in a warehouse or retail store. The forks move down and up by a telescopic hydraulic cylinder on the lift truck mast. Various sets of hydraulic cylinders are utilized to tilt the mast and shift it to the side, for positioning. A telescopic hydraulic cylinder is a type of attachment which enables an even higher lift utilizing a hydraulic cylinder system that works a lot like a telescope. Every section slides inside the other similar to sections of a telescope.

Features
Separate levers control the down and up, tilt, and side shift. To lift the forks, the driver pulls back on the down and up lever. To lower the forks, the operator pushes the lever forward. Tilt the load back by pulling back the lever, push it forward to tilt the load forward. The side shift lever controls the forks right and left movement. Not like cars, forklifts steer from the back tires. This allows the forklift to turn in a very small radius. The transmission forward and reverse controls are found on the steering column.
